Ibrahimovic: A €40m Milan move in the works

The Spanish media outlets are saying that a deal is in the works that will bring Ibra to AC Milan for €40m which will be payable in three instalments. The player has asked for a day more to think things through before coming to a decision. (as per AS.com)

He has also agreed to lower his wages to €8m per annum.
